War weary Europeans test their leaders' resolve

Whoever ends up presiding over Afghan chaos and corruption, Europe is losing patience fast with U.S. mission muddle and a president who won’t make up his mind.

NATO defense ministers meeting last week in Slovakia backed Gen. Stanley McChrystal’s strategy to strike harder, and fast, against a growing insurgency.
